Requests to move Adjournment of Dáil under Standing Order 31.

 

5:00 pm

Photo of Dan BoyleDan Boyle (Cork South Central, Green Party)

I seek the adjournment of the Dáil under Standing Order 31 to debate the following urgent matter: to allow the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Employment and the Minister for Justice, Equality and Law Reform to make statements to the House regarding the refusal of immigration officials at Cork Airport to allow entry to an Australian citizen travelling to this country for the purpose of a job interview and his subsequent imprisonment at a Cork Garda station.
